Chemical and Physical Properties

Solubility Decomposes in water.
Sensitivity Moisture sensitive.
Refractive Index 1.459
Flash Point(°F) 404.6 °F
Flash Point(°C) 207°C
Boil Point(°C) 223 °C/10 mmHg
Melt Point(°C) ca20°
Molecular Weight 387.900 g/mol
